I don't think I have ever seen a switch with a feature like that. Why would you want to do such a thing, have you found some sort of a memory leak on the switch?
Or is your concern more indirect (meaning it isn't the DES-3200-28P you want to reboot, but whatever it is powering perhaps)? If that is the case, then the common solution would be to assign a time range to the poe ports that excludes a second when you want the reboot to happen.
Either way, I can't think of any reason to want a feature like this except as a bandaid for a much more serious problem.
